Программирование - это настройка и написания логики взаимодействия различных устройств и систем умного дома.
Что входит в программирование?
1. Интеграция устройств, которые работают по разным протоколам в одну систему.
- Приточная вентиляция
- Кондиционирование
- Увлажнители
Эти устройства управляются по промышленным протоколам (BACnet, eBUS, MODBUS RTU, MODBUS TCP, RS-485, RS-232 и тд) их невозможно автоматизировать с помощью обычных умных девайсов, таких как xioami.
Программист Умного дома пишет скриптовые драйверы для управления этими устройствами.
2. Программирование освещения - интеграция различных протоколов управления DMX, DALI, KNX.
Настройка глобальной логики работы освещения.
- Диммирование
- Таймеры
- Астротаймеры (автоматическое управление светом по световому дню и погоде)
- Датчики присутствия (движения)
3. Разработка индивидуальных сценариев управления системой Умный дом, в зависимости от образа жизни (дети, семья, увлечения, отношение к музыке и кино и другое)
4. Программирование аудио и видео - настройка аудио-видео матриц и аудио-процессоров, калибровка пространственного звука для помещений с помощью специального 3-d микрофона.
5. Создание визуальных интерфейсов и интеграция голосовых помощников (ждите в следующих постах!)
Программирование в Умном доме очень важный и ключевой элемент системы. Это одно из главных отличий дешевых умных устройств от полноценной системы UNECOM - умный дом
Instagram